Hello...i am running a 3300A with a bing carb. lately i have been having issues. If i pull the throttle cable back till it stops it stalls the engine...if i adjust the cable to full throttle it starts missing during climb out like it has too much fuel and i have begun having issues with carb ice. at least it acts like carb ice when i pull on the carb heat it runs rough and then straightens out....my worst issue is the engine stall...anyone have similar issues and fixes?

Don:  Thanks for the suggestions.  I have adjusted the prop slightly, and that helped.  My engine came with a 255 main jet, and I moved first to a 250 and then to a 245.  That has also helped.  Next time I have the cowl off, I'll pay careful attention to the scat hose leading to the carb and will make it as straight as possible.  I just searched for your prior posts on the Bing, but did not find them.  Tom
